Background
Stephan is a Fellow of the Australian Royal College of General Practitioners. He has an interest in men’s health, women’s and children’s health and does perform minor surgical procedures. He believes in providing a patient centred, evidence based approach to general practice.
Stephan was born in Germany and has completed his tertiary education in the UK. He graduated from Leicester University Medical School in 2006.
After completing two years of internship he started training as a general surgeon for several years and subsequently became a Member of the Royal College of Surgeons of England. He then changed his career interests to general practice and after three further years of postgraduate education achieved Membership of the Royal College of General Practitioners.
He has lived in the UK for 20 years before moving to Brisbane in 2017.
